Thomas Kinkade - NY Time Best-Selling Author
Many might not know this but Thomas Kinkade is also a NY Times best-selling author of two series - Cape Light and Angel Island , which he co-wrote with Katherine Spencer.
Cape Light series consists of eleven books:
- Cape Light
- Home Song
- A Gathering Place
- A New Leaf
- A Christmas Promise
- The Christmas Angel
- A Christmas To Remember
- A Christmas Visitor
- A Christmas Star
- A Wish For Christmas
- On Christmas Eve
Angel Island series consists of two books so far (more surely to be written):
- The Inn At Angel Island
- The Wedding Promise
